Who’s the most complete keeper in the Premier League: Alisson or Ederson? Did Aaron Ramsdale deserve to lose his place to David Raya in the Arsenal goal? And why did he love working for Jose Mourinho at Chelsea? These are some of the questions Jeff puts to former Middlesbrough, Fulham and Australia keeper Mark Schwarzer on this week’s pod.  They also discuss how he was left fuming with Mark Hughes and Fulham when a potential move to Arsenal collapsed in 2010, why he’s backing his Aussie compatriot Ange Postecoglu to be a success at Tottenham and he reveals why modern keepers have one eye on the cameras when making saves now. Plus he explains why he thinks last summer was the right time for David de Gea to leave Manchester United, which Liverpool keeper threw the ball like a javelin and why the Champions League theme music still gives him goosebumps.
